Casius is a name often given to boys. Ranked #12540 and holds a steady place on the charts. It comes from a Latin (Roman) origin and traditionally means "Hollow or empty, from ancient Roman Cassius clan". It has 2 syllables.
Casius derives from the Roman gens Cassia, linked to the Latin word cassus meaning hollow or empty. Historically tied to noble families, it evokes strength and intellect. Today it offers parents a rare, powerful choice with classical roots and contemporary appeal for a son destined for leadership.
